Weighted stationary phase of higher orders
Abstract
An nth-order first derivative test for oscillatoric integrals is established. When the phase has a single stationary point, an nth-order asymptotic expansion of a weighted stationary phase integral is proved for arbitrary n≥1. This asymptotic expansion sharpened the classical result for n=1 by Huxley. Possible applications include analysis and analytic number theory.
